About the role
We're an established accountancy practice in Ealing looking after a broad portfolio of owner-managed businesses — limited companies, sole traders and partnerships across a wide range of sectors. No two clients look the same, and the work is varied because of it.
This is a hands-on role for someone who already knows their way around a set of accounts. You'll look after your own group of clients, keeping their books current, preparing their compliance work, and dealing with them directly. You'll have the team around you, but you won't be micro-managed.
What you'll be doing
- Bookkeeping across a portfolio of clients — purchase and sales ledgers, bank reconciliations, control accounts, asset ledger
- Preparing VAT returns and filing them under MTD
- Running weekly and monthly payroll, including RTI and auto-enrolment
- Preparing self-assessment tax returns
- Working up trial balances and assisting with limited company accounts preparation
- Contacting clients for records, chasing outstanding information and answering day-to-day queries
- Drafting client letters and correspondence
What you'll need
Essential
- Solid experience in a UK accountancy practice — you've prepared self-assessments, worked to a trial balance and assisted on limited company accounts before
- Confident with double entry and reconciliations, including working from incomplete records
- Practical knowledge of UK VAT and payroll compliance
- QuickBooks Online, and the adaptability to pick up other systems quickly
- Strong Excel
- Able to communicate clearly with clients in written and spoken English, since the role is client-facing
- Organised enough to manage your own deadlines across several clients at once
Helpful
- AAT qualified, or part-qualified ACCA/ACA
- Experience with MTD for Income Tax
- Exposure to a mixed portfolio rather than a single sector
